Bathroom Tile Repair in Conroe, TX
Bathroom tile repair services focus on restoring the appearance and functionality of tiled surfaces in bathrooms, addressing issues such as cracked, chipped, or stained tiles, as well as damaged grout or loose tiles. These projects typically include replacing broken tiles, regrouting, sealing, and fixing underlying issues that may cause tiles to loosen or shift over time. Homeowners often seek this service to improve the overall look of their bathroom, prevent water damage, and maintain the integrity of tiled surfaces, especially in high-moisture areas like showers, tubs, and floors.
Before requesting bathroom tile repair, property owners should assess the extent of the damage and consider whether the issues are limited to surface tiles or indicate underlying problems such as water leaks or structural concerns. Understanding the type of tile material, the age of the installation, and the desired outcome can help determine the appropriate repair approach. Accurate information about the scope of the project ensures proper planning and helps achieve a durable, visually appealing result.

Common Bathroom Tile Repair Jobs
Grout Repair - restoring damaged or stained grout to improve tile appearance and prevent water damage.
Cracked Tile Replacement - replacing broken or cracked tiles to maintain the integrity of bathroom surfaces.
Tile Re-sealing - applying sealant to protect tiles and grout from moisture and staining.
Surface Refinishing - restoring the look of worn or dull tiles through cleaning and polishing.
Leak Repair - fixing leaks behind tiles to prevent water damage and mold growth.
Mosaic and Accent Tile Repair - repairing or replacing decorative tiles to preserve design details.
Bathroom Tile Repair Questions
What types of bathroom tile damage can be repaired? Common issues like cracks, chips, and grout deterioration can be addressed to restore the appearance and functionality of bathroom tiles.
Is tile replacement necessary for all damage? Not always; minor cracks or chips can often be repaired without full replacement, saving time and effort.
How does tile repair improve bathroom durability? Repairing damaged tiles helps prevent water seepage and further deterioration, extending the life of the tile surfaces.
What should property owners consider before tile repair? It's important to assess the extent of damage and choose repair methods that match existing tile styles for a seamless look.
